Popular Types of Swing Set Accessories
Swing Seats
Swing seats come in various designs, catering to different age groups and preferences. Bucket swings are perfect for toddlers, providing safety and support. On the other hand, tire swings offer a fun, communal experience for older children. Climbing Structures
Climbing structures, such as rock walls and nets, are fantastic for developing strength and coordination. These accessories challenge children physically while providing hours of fun. They are often made from durable materials to withstand outdoor elements and repeated use. Safety Accessories
Safety should never be compromised when it comes to children’s play equipment. Accessories like ground anchors and padding are essential for ensuring that swing sets remain stable and secure. Additionally, soft landing zones beneath swings can prevent injuries. Adventure World Play Sets emphasizes the importance of safety in their product offerings.

Technical Features Comparison
Accessory Type | Material | Weight Capacity | Safety Features | Installation Ease |
---|---|---|---|---|
Swing Seats | Plastic/Wood | Up to 250 lbs | Safety harness, padded edges | Easy |
Climbing Structures | Heavy-duty plastic/wood | Up to 300 lbs | Non-slip surfaces, sturdy design | Moderate |
Slides | Plastic | Up to 200 lbs | Rounded edges, safety rails | Easy |
Playhouses | Wood/Plastic | N/A | Ventilation, non-toxic finishes | Moderate |
Sandboxes | Wood/Plastic | N/A | Rounded edges, covers available | Easy |
Accessory Kits | Various | Varies | All components child-safe | Moderate |
Safety Accessories | Various | N/A | Ground anchors, padding | Easy |
Sports Accessories | Plastic/Metal | Varies | Stable base, padded edges | Easy |

How can I ensure my swing set is stable with added accessories?
Use ground anchors and ensure proper installation of all accessories. Regularly check for wear and tear to maintain stability.

How often should I inspect my swing set and accessories?
It’s advisable to inspect your swing set and accessories at least once a month or after heavy use to ensure they remain safe.
